Aligning your lifestyle with joint-supporting practices is essential for men who strive for a high level of physical activity. As we age, our joints naturally experience stress. By embracing a holistic approach that encompasses food choices, targeted activities, and recovery time, you can fortify your joints, boost mobility, and minimize the risk of future pain or restrictions.
- Focus on a healthy diet rich in vitamins to protect joint tissues.
- Engage in regular resistance exercises to build the muscles that stabilize your joints.
- Integrate low-impact exercises like swimming, cycling, or walking into your routine to enhance joint flexibility and range of motion.

Age Gracefully|Maintaining Flexibility and Joint Strength
As we reach our golden years, it's crucial to emphasize maintaining their flexibility and joint strength. Regular exercise can help improve mobility, reduce the risk of pain, and promote overall well-being.
Consider incorporating tai chi into your routine. These can gently flex muscles and boost joint flexibility.
Additionally, try strength training exercises that work major muscle groups. This will strengthen bone density and support your joints.
Remember to speak with your physician before starting any new exercise program, especially if you have pre-existing health concerns.
